Output e629fe8a76f1090185f855be80cf93ed32213a8cdb0f69ee5c102cb5084eccb4:1

value
268190
script pubkey
OP_0 OP_PUSHBYTES_20 e8863b12c8f34979ce240eff66ada6341a137ccb
address
bc1qazrrkykg7dyhnn3ypmlkdtdxxsdpxlxtt9m7d4
transaction
e629fe8a76f1090185f855be80cf93ed32213a8cdb0f69ee5c102cb5084eccb4
confirmations
43814
spent
true